This civil revision filed under Section 23E of the Chhattisgarh Accommodation Control Act, 1961 (for short “the Act of 1961”) read with Section 115 of the Code of Civil Procedure, 1908 (for short “CPC”) is directed against the impugned order dated 27.07.2019 passed by the Rent Controlling Authority, whereby the application filed by the non-applicant herein (landlord/plaintiff) under Section 23A of the Act of 1961 has been allowed and a decree of eviction has been passed in his favour vis-a-vis the applicant herein (tenant/defendant) has been directed to vacate the suit premises within two months from the date of the order.
